The Role
At Neo, we are reimagining how Canadians experience financial products, making them smarter, simpler, and more rewarding. Our team is growing quickly, and we are looking for a Lifecycle Operations Manager to join us in building meaningful customer experiences through powerful communications and campaigns.
The Lifecycle Operations Manager is a marketer with systems thinking who will own the technical backbone of Neo’s customer communication ecosystem. This role is the power operator of Iterable - executing communication strategies through workflows, automations, and complex logic that connect across channels.
They act as the bridge between marketing strategy and technical execution, ensuring campaigns are built efficiently, delivered flawlessly, and tracked accurately. They continuously refine processes, maintain workflow health, and ensure compliance, data accuracy, and system scalability as new initiatives are launched.
What you'll be doing:
Identify inefficiencies in workflows and customer journeys, and propose scalable, long-term solutions.
Scope and maintain CRM and attribution tracking documentation for new initiatives.
Manage deep link setup and QA across campaigns and journeys.
Own QA for language, grammar, compliance, and technical delivery.
Support setup and deployment of non-product communications through Iterable.
Partner with marketing, product, and analytics teams to ensure flawless execution and reporting.
Who we are looking for:
Bachelor's degree in Marketing, Business, Statistics, or a related field.
Proficient in Excel / Google Sheets.
Deep experience with marketing automation platforms (Iterable, Marketo, Eloqua, Salesforce Marketing Cloud, Hubspot)
Deep understanding of data and analytics and how they can relate to marketing initiatives.
A vision for personalized communications and digital marketing
Passion for working in a startup with a high velocity output
Logical and analytical thought process
Ability to understand technical information at a fast pace
Previous experience using html, css, or handlebars for campaign template creation to support dynamic content
